| Package | Description | 
|---|---|
| com.sun.jini.start | |
| net.jini.security.policy | 
| Constructor and Description | 
|---|
AggregatePolicyProvider()
Creates a new  
AggregatePolicyProvider instance, containing a main policy created
 as follows: if the com.sun.jini.start.AggregatePolicyProvider.mainPolicyClass
 security property is set, then its value is interpreted as the class name of the main policy
 provider; otherwise, a default class name of "net.jini.security.policy.DynamicPolicyProvider"
 is used. | 
| Constructor and Description | 
|---|
DynamicPolicyProvider()
Creates a new  
DynamicPolicyProvider instance that wraps a default underlying
 policy. | 
PolicyFileProvider()
Creates a  
PolicyFileProvider whose starting set of permission mappings is the
 same as those that would result from constructing a new instance of the J2SE default security
 policy provider with the current java.security.policy system property setting
 (if any), except that UmbrellaGrantPermissions are expanded into
 GrantPermissions as described in the documentation for UmbrellaGrantPermission. | 
PolicyFileProvider(String policyFile)
Creates a  
PolicyFileProvider whose starting set of permission mappings is the
 same as those that would result from constructing a new instance of the J2SE default security
 policy provider with the java.security.policy system property set to the value
 of policyFile, except that UmbrellaGrantPermissions are expanded
 into GrantPermissions as described in the documentation for UmbrellaGrantPermission. | 
Copyright © GigaSpaces.